Ram Navami Festival | Significance & Celebration
Ram Navami celebrates the birth of Lord Ram, a major deity in Hinduism. It signifies the victory of good over evil. Celebrated on the ninth day of Chaitra month, it is a time for reverence and devotion. Traditions include prayers, singing hymns, and community gatherings. The festival inspires people to walk the path of righteousness. Many devotees observe fasting on this auspicious day. Various events and processions are conducted to honor Lord Ram.

Chaitra Navratri | Day 7 Significance
Chaitra Navratri is a nine-night festival celebrating the goddess Durga. Each day has its unique significance and rituals. Day 7 is particularly devoted to the worship of Maa Durga's form as Kaalratri. Devotees seek her blessings for protection and strength. It is believed that she dispels darkness and ignorance. Celebrating Navratri brings spiritual upliftment and community bonding. The festival emphasizes the triumph of good over evil.

Happy Chaitra Navratri | Day 9 Celebration
Chaitra Navratri is a significant Hindu festival celebrated over nine days. It honors Goddess Durga and her various forms. The ninth day of Navratri, known as Navami, is dedicated to the worship of Goddess Siddhidatri. Devotees seek her blessings for strength, wisdom, and success. This festival symbolizes the victory of good over evil. Chaitra Navratri promotes spiritual awakening and devotion. Celebrating this day involves special prayers, rituals, and community gatherings.

Happy Ram Navami | Significance and Celebrations
Ram Navami marks the birthday of Lord Rama, a significant deity in Hinduism. It is celebrated on the ninth day of Chaitra month according to the Hindu calendar. The festival emphasizes dharma and virtue, symbolizing the victory of good over evil. People celebrate by singing bhajans and performing pujas. Temples are adorned, and processions are held in honor of Lord Rama. Devotees seek blessings for strength and wisdom. Observances can include fasting and reading the Ramayana.
